Description

The shrimp processing generates a high volume of waste constituted by the cephalothorax that is disposed of in a sanitary landfill. These residues contain 40% protein and 24% chitin that can be used to produce balanced fish feed and improve agricultural production by marketing it as seed cover. The project proposes to recover the protein from shrimp residues by enzymatic hydrolysis for the production of balanced feed, and recover the chitin for the production of mixed hydrocolloid that will be used for seed coverage in order to contribute to improving the productivity of the agricultural sector.
